Does anyone know the most effective way to level a subfloor prior to installing laminate flooring? I have a 14x34 sunroom addition that i'm going to install the laminate flooring in. There are some low spots on the 3/4 in subfloor. Do they make a "slurry" of some sort to make leveling easy. If you have any product makers pls pass them on. Thanks in advance

Self leveling concrete (SLC) is available from flooring sundries distributors everywhere. Have your considered the expansion potential of a room of this size?
